Page 21 text:

VIRGINIA ALLEEN BIRNIE Ginny” S. A. 2, 3, 4; Girls ' League 2, 3, 4; Photography Club 2, 3, 4; Senior Literary Club 3, 4; Honor Society 3, 4; Choir B 2, 3, 4; Choir C 2, 3, 4; All State Chorus. Never tardy; no demerits. Burr Junior High School. Mr. Daly’s bad little girl. . . much of high school career in Room 169 • • • for some strange reason, she preferred collecting records to recording Chemistry for¬ mulas . . . bewitched, bothered, and bewildered by Macbeth. THERESA IRENE BOLDUC Tess” S . A. 2, 3, 4; Home Economics Club 1; Girls’ League 2, 3, 4. Never tardy; no demerits. Burr Junior High School. Pleasing personality . . . easy to get along with . . . always on the go, as shown by her interests in rollerskating, bowling, swimming, and dancing. SOPHIE THERESA BONGIOVANNI Lochia” S. A. 2, 3, 4; Girls ' League 2, 3, 4. Burr Junior High School. A lively, fun-loving girl with a pleasing personality . . . her sense of humor and natural sociability certainly provided much entertainment among her many friends . . . her sunny smile brightened many a gloomy day for her classmates. WILLIAM HAIG BOORNAZIAN Bosh” S. A. 1, 2, 3, 4; Boys’ Club 1, 2, 3, 4; Track 2, 3, Letter 2, 3; Cross Country 2, 3, Letter 2, 3, Captain 3; Football 4; Baseball 4. Never tardy. Washington Street School. University of Connecticut. A versatile athlete specializing in three sports . . . often subject to moods . . . Bosh” could almost always be found with the boys,” but it’s rumored that the fairer sex were by no means ignored by Valentino.” NANCY ALICE BRADY Nan” S .A. 2, 3, 4; Girls’ League 2, 3, 4. No demerits. Burr Junior High School. Quiet . . . friendly . . . lovely blonde hair . . . has a winning smile . . . happy when with her best beau, Sonny” . . . likes dancing, swimming, and sewing. 17

Page 22 text:

MICHAEL FRANCIS BRESCIA Mike” S. A. 2, 3, 4; Boys’ Club 2, 3; Art Club 4; Junior Literary Club 2; Edison Science Club 4; Torch 2, 3, 4, Co-assistant Editor 4; Scholastic Writing Honorable Mention 3. Burr Junior High School. What would the Torch” have done without Mike? ... a definite asset to this school publication ... he excels in science and journalism and should find success in either field. NANCE CAROL BRODERICK Nan” S. A. 2, 3, 4; Girls ' League 2, 3, 4; Torch Typist 3, 4; Committee for J. C. C. City Beautiful Campaign 3; Baton Twirler 3, 4. Never tardy; no demerits. Cathedral High School. One of Bulkeley’s attractive twirlers . . . liked by all . . . always ready to laugh and have a good time . . . Point O’ Woods is her idea of a summer vacation. MARLINE JOYCE BROWN Cookie” S. A. 2, 3; Girls’ League 2, 3, 4. No demerits. Weaver High School. Sparkling smile . . . well dressed . . . very, nice to look at . . . although she came to Bulkeley in her junior year, Marline’s charming personality quickly won her many friends. JOSEPH LOUIS BRUNO Joe” S. A. 2, 3, 4; Boys’ Club 2, 3, 4; Football 2, 3, 4, Letter 3, 4; Track 2; Intramural Basketball 2, 3, 4. Burr Junior High School. Whitney Art School. A wonderful sense of humor that made him a favorite among all . . . his fun- loving antics helped to brighten up many a dull classroom . . . Joe’s sparkling play on the gridiron proved his athletic ability and sportsmanship. BETTY JEAN-ANN BUTLER Betty” S. A. 1, 2, 3, 4; Girls’ League 1, 2, 3, 4, Room Representative 1, 2, 3, 4. Never tardy; no demerits. Southwest School. A lovely girl with a beautiful velvet complexion . . . sweet and quiet . . . has beautiful clothes and wears them well... her hobbies are music, sports, and dancing. 18
